diff --git a/src/details/registry.cpp b/src/details/registry.cpp index efb555c3..9ac0d95c 100644 --- a/src/details/registry.cpp +++ b/src/details/registry.cpp @@ -70,7 +70,7 @@ namespace spdlog { // if the map is small do a sequential search, otherwise use the standard find() std::shared_ptr registry::get(const std::string &logger_name) { - if (loggers_.size() <= 20) { + if (loggers_.size() <= 10) { for (const auto &[key, val]: loggers_) { if (logger_name == key) { return val; @@ -89,7 +89,7 @@ namespace spdlog { std::shared_ptr registry::get(std::string_view logger_name) { std::lock_guard lock(logger_map_mutex_); - if (loggers_.size() <= 20) { + if (loggers_.size() <= 10) { for (const auto &[key, val]: loggers_) { if (logger_name == key) { return val;